#5c3bc8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5c3bc8 is composed of 36.1% red, 23.1%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54% cyan, 70.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 254 degrees, a saturation of 56.2% and a lightness of 50.8%. #5c3bc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#b876ff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5c3bc8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5c3bc8 has RGB values of R:92, G:59,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 6044616.
